Direct Agents, a leading interactive advertising agency, and AccuQuote, a leader in providing term life insurance quotes to people across the United States, are pleased to announce today their selection as finalists for the prestigious ad:tech Limelight Awards. The ad:tech Limelight Awards celebrate extraordinary industry achievements in online advertising and recognize talented online designers and strategic thinkers who demonstrate excellence in interactive marketing. The award winners will be announced at the ad:tech San Francisco 'Awards Mixer' on April 21st.
BantamLive.com, a new online workspace for business teams, has been chosen by a panel of Web 2.0 Expo judges as one of five finalist winners to present and launch its software-as-a-service application on April 2nd at the Moscone Center in San Francisco as part of the Web 2.0 Expo. The event will mark the private-beta debut of Bantam, a web-based application that fuses social media with CRM for business teams. It has been developed by Bantam Networks, based in New York City.
Revenue Sharing for Filmmakers
Complements Cash Reward Program
Openfilm.com, the video sharing
network for independent filmmakers and fans of quality web video, today
announced the launch of its ad revenue sharing program available to all
Openfilm content providers. The program offers one of the highest revenue
shares in the online video industry, with 50 percent of the ad revenue going
directly to the filmmaker.
Transaction Positions Adknowledge for
Continued, Strong Growth
Adknowledge announced today that it
has acquired the Media division of MIVA, Inc. MIVA Media, one of the largest
independent online performance advertising networks, was founded in 1999 and
includes the Espotting and Findwhat.com brands. Another of MIVA, Inc.’s
divisions, MIVA Direct, was not affected by the transaction and continues to be
owned and operated by MIVA, Inc. Going forward, Adknowledge will retain the
MIVA, Findwhat.com, and Espotting brands.
Canwest Global Communications Corp.
(“Canwest”) announced today that it has received $34 million in full settlement
of amounts owing to its subsidiary, Canwest Media Inc. (“CMI”) and Canwest
Publications Inc., pursuant to an arbitration award in connection with its
dispute with Hollinger International Inc. – now Sun-Times Media Group, Inc. –
and related parties (“Hollinger”).
Study Conducted by Return Path’s New Professional Services Group
Online retailers have spent years
optimizing their digital marketing and customer retention strategy. However,
many online retailers still struggle to maximize the numerous sales opportunities
available through more effective email marketing, a new study from Return Path
reveals. The Increasing Revenues By Optimizing Emailing Practices with
Online Buyers report conducted by Return Path’s newly revamped
Professional Services Group discovered that while basic transactional email
practices are excellent, many well-known brands missed opportunities to
maximize sales and up-sell potential by better targeting messages to buyers and
including promotions in transactional messaging.
